Johannesburg, South Africa — Thandeka Tshabalala, a contestant on the reality show “Big Brother Mzansi, “has publicly accused the program of rigging after her defeat in the final round by Liema Pantsi. This claim has ignited a significant controversy in South Africa.
Tshabalala, who did not provide specific evidence for her allegations, has called for an investigation into the integrity of the show. She maintains that the victory of Pantsi was not a result of fair competition.
The “Big Brother Mzansi “franchise has been a popular fixture on South African television, drawing large audiences. However, this year’s edition has faced heightened scrutiny following Tshabalala’s accusations.
Producers of the show have not yet issued a response to Tshabalala’s claims. Meanwhile, the controversy has prompted a lively debate on social media, with fans and critics divided over the authenticity of the show’s content and the treatment of its participants.
